The first and the pioneer Province in China-Israel Science and Technology Cooperation
In 2014, Ministry of Science and Technology (MOST) of China, Jiangsu Province and Ministry of Economy of Israel signed the agreement to jointly promote the development of China-Israel Changzhou Innovation Park.
In 2008, Jiangsu Province signed industrial R&D cooperation agreement with Israel and set up joint funding mechanism to support R&D projects by companies from both sides. Up to now, both sides have accomplished 11 calls for proposals and jointly supported more than 50 projects.
✦
In 2012, Jiangsu and Finland signed the agreement and established a similar mechanism of industrial R&D cooperation. Up to now, both sides have accomplished 3 calls for proposals and jointly supported more than 20 projects.
✦
In 2014, Jiangsu signed the MOU on regional technology and innovation cooperation with Innovate UK;
✦
In 2015, Jiangsu signed the MOU on science and technology cooperation with the Technology Agency of the Czech Republic; signed the agreement on technology and innovation cooperation with the Department of Economic Development, Jobs, Transport and Resources of Victoria, Australia; signed the MOU on technology and innovation cooperation with the Ministry of Research and Innovation of Ontario, Canada.
✦
According to the above 4 MOU and agreements, recently Jiangsu is going to establish co-funding programs with these 4 countries or regions.

Jiangsu has also built in-depth collaborative relationships with prestigious universities and research institutions in the world, and facilitated the establishment of international cooperative platforms in Jiangsu by overseas innovative organizations and technology transfer institutions.
Since 2010, a number of innovative platforms have been set up in
Jiangsu, including Suzhou Institute of National University of Singapore, UCLA-Suzhou Institute of Technology Advancement (ITA), China-Finland Nano-tech & Innovation Center, China-
Australia (Wuxi) Light Alloy Joint Research Center, Sheng-BDO (Wuxi) Technology Transfer Company of Israel, ISIS (Changzhou, Suzhou) International Tech Transfer Center of University of Oxford, WORLDiscoveries
ASIA (China Center) of University of Western Ontario of Canada, etc.
In 2013, Jiangsu signed the agreement with Fraunhofer-Gesellschaft
of Germany on the exchange program of visiting scientists, to support scientists from Jiangsu industrial circles to carry out joint research at Fraunhofer
institutes.

In 2013, Jiangsu and MIT signed the Industrial Liaison Program (ILP) agreement on industrial technology cooperation, to promote R&D cooperation between Jiangsu companies and MIT professors. This is the first institutional-level agreement of its kind signed between MIT and a provincial government in China.
